1. Technical SEO Analysis

Website Speed ​​and Core Webpage Index
Google will place more emphasis on user experience in 2025. Indicators such as LCP (maximum content rendering time), FID (first input delay), and CLS (cumulative layout shift) directly affect rankings. It is necessary to check whether the loading speed of the website meets the standard (recommended to be less than 2.5 seconds), whether image compression and code streamlining are optimized, etc.
If the website is custom developed, it is necessary to ensure that the technical architecture (such as server response, CDN configuration) meets the optimization standards.
Mobile Adaptation and Responsive Design
Google has fully switched to mobile-first indexing, and it is necessary to confirm whether the website's display effect, navigation fluency, and interactive experience on the mobile terminal are good. According to statistics, 72.6% of users will only access the Internet through mobile phones in 2025, so mobile optimization is crucial.
Security and HTTPS
HTTPS is a basic requirement. You need to ensure that the SSL certificate is enabled throughout the site to avoid mixed content problems.

2. Content Strategy Evaluation

Content Quality and E-E-A-T Principles
Google's 2025 algorithm update pays more attention to content originality, professionalism, and credibility (E-E-A-T), especially in YMYL fields such as health and finance. It is necessary to evaluate whether the website content is written by experts in the field and whether it contains original research or data support.
Avoid using pure AI-generated content, which needs to be manually reviewed and optimized to comply with the "user first" principle.
Content Structure and SEO Adaptability
Long content (3000+ words) performs better, bringing 3 times the traffic and 4 times the sharing rate. It is necessary to check whether the article covers the topic in depth, and use structured formats such as H2/H3 titles, lists, and tables to improve readability and AI crawling efficiency.
Optimize for different user intents (TOFU/MOFU/BOFU), and focus on commercial intent keywords (such as "best tool comparison") to improve conversion rate.
Multimedia Integration
Video content can increase traffic by 157%. It is recommended to embed video tutorials or case demonstrations, and optimize video titles and descriptions.

3. Keywords and Ranking Performance

Keyword Coverage and Search Intent Matching
High ranking content needs to accurately match user search intent, for example, question-type keywords (such as "how to optimize SEO") need to provide direct answers. According to the suggestions on page 2, the conversion rate of middle and lower funnel (MOFU/BOFU) content is higher and needs to be optimized first.
Long-tail keywords account for 94.74%, and low-competition high-value words need to be mined through tools (such as SEMrush).
Structured Data and AI Summary Optimization
Adding schemas such as FAQ and product tags can increase the probability of content being cited by AI summaries (52% of AI summaries come from Top10 results). It is recommended to embed concise definitions and tables in TOFU content to adapt to Google AI Overviews.

4. External Optimization and Authority

Backlink Quality
High-quality external links are still the core ranking factor, but spam links should be avoided. The average number of external links for the top 1 result is 3.8 times that of the 2-10 results. It is recommended to obtain authoritative external links through original research, industry cooperation or guest blogging.
Local SEO and Voice Search
Optimize Google My Business information for local searches, and optimize natural language keywords (such as "SEO services nearby") to adapt to the growing trend of voice search.
